How do perennial weeds reproduce?

Perennial weeds are a persistent problem for gardeners and farmers alike, primarily due to their ability to reproduce in multiple ways. Understanding these reproductive methods is crucial for effective weed management. Perennial weeds reproduce both sexually through seeds and asexually through vegetative parts such as roots, rhizomes, and stolons, allowing them to spread and thrive in various environments.

How Do Perennial Weeds Reproduce?

Perennial weeds have developed several strategies to ensure their survival and spread. These methods are often categorized into sexual reproduction and asexual reproduction.

Sexual Reproduction via Seeds

Many perennial weeds produce seeds that can remain viable in the soil for several years. This method of reproduction allows them to spread over long distances as seeds can be transported by wind, water, animals, or human activity.

  • Seed Longevity: Some weed seeds can remain dormant yet viable for decades, waiting for the right conditions to germinate.
  • Seed Dispersal: Mechanisms like wind (dandelions), water (knotweed), and animals (burdock) help in spreading seeds far from the parent plant.

Asexual Reproduction Through Vegetative Parts

Asexual reproduction is a significant factor in the resilience and spread of many perennial weeds. This method involves the growth of new plants from parts of the parent plant, such as roots, rhizomes, stolons, and tubers.

  • Rhizomes: Underground stems that grow horizontally and can produce new shoots and roots at nodes. Examples include quackgrass and Canada thistle.
  • Stolons: Above-ground horizontal stems that root at nodes to form new plants, as seen in creeping Charlie.
  • Tubers and Bulbs: Underground storage organs that can give rise to new plants, like nutsedge and wild garlic.

Why Are Perennial Weeds So Persistent?

The combination of sexual and asexual reproduction makes perennial weeds particularly difficult to control. Their ability to regenerate from small fragments of roots or stems means that even after physical removal, they can quickly re-establish.

  • Regeneration: Even small pieces of root left in the soil can regrow into a full plant.
  • Adaptability: Perennial weeds can thrive in a variety of environments and conditions, making them highly adaptable and competitive.

Effective Control Strategies for Perennial Weeds

Managing perennial weeds requires a comprehensive approach that targets both their seeds and vegetative parts.

  1. Cultural Control: Implement crop rotation and cover cropping to suppress weed growth.
  2. Mechanical Control: Regular mowing, tilling, and hand-pulling can reduce weed populations, though care must be taken to remove all root parts.
  3. Chemical Control: Use of herbicides can be effective, especially when combined with other methods. Selective herbicides target specific weeds without harming desired plants.
  4. Biological Control: Introduce natural predators or diseases that specifically target certain perennial weeds.

Examples of Common Perennial Weeds

Understanding specific perennial weeds and their characteristics can help in developing targeted control strategies.

Weed Name Reproduction Method Control Strategy
Dandelion Seeds, Taproots Hand-pulling, Herbicides
Quackgrass Rhizomes, Seeds Tilling, Selective Herbicides
Creeping Charlie Stolons, Seeds Mowing, Herbicides
Canada Thistle Rhizomes, Seeds Mowing, Biological Control

People Also Ask

What Are the Most Common Perennial Weeds?

Common perennial weeds include dandelions, quackgrass, creeping Charlie, and Canada thistle. These weeds are known for their ability to reproduce both sexually and asexually, making them difficult to control.

How Can I Prevent Perennial Weeds from Spreading?

Preventing the spread of perennial weeds involves a combination of regular monitoring, timely removal, and the use of barriers or mulches to suppress growth. Ensuring healthy soil and plant competition can also reduce weed establishment.

Are There Natural Methods to Control Perennial Weeds?

Yes, natural methods include using mulches to block light, applying vinegar or salt solutions as spot treatments, and encouraging beneficial insects or animals that feed on weeds. Crop rotation and dense planting can also naturally suppress weed growth.

How Do Perennial Weeds Affect Agriculture?

Perennial weeds compete with crops for nutrients, water, and light, leading to reduced yields. They can also harbor pests and diseases that affect crops. Effective management is essential to minimize their impact on agriculture.

Can Perennial Weeds Be Completely Eradicated?

Complete eradication of perennial weeds is challenging due to their reproductive strategies. However, consistent and integrated management practices can significantly reduce their populations and impact over time.
